FIGURE 21. Male holotype of Temnomastax beni Rehn & Rehn, 1942. A—dorsal view, B—habitus, C—ventral view. Blue arrow—concavity on the fastigium-occipital junction; Red arrows—absence of black ring in the ¼ distal of metafemur; Green arrows—fistuliform process in the posterior margin of subgenital plate. Scale bar = 5 mm. (Photos by Karolyn Darrow, MSC).
Published as part of Olivier, Renan S., Pujol-Luz, Cristiane V.A. & Graciolli, Gustavo, 2019, Review of Temnomastax Rehn & Rehn, 1942 (Orthoptera, Caelifera, Eumastacidae, Temnomastacinae), pp. 1-78 in Zootaxa 4593 (1) on page 30, DOI: 10.11646/zootaxa.4593.1.1, http://zenodo.org/record/2657006
